The Riddles of Epsilon. Christine Morton-Shaw. New York, HarperCollins Children’s Books, 2005.
By Article Editor | Sep 18, 2010
Past-present-future-past…they are all the same, according to the character Epsilon, and first-time novelist Morton-Shaw does a surprising job of rendering esoteric to credible in this ageless story for tweens to young teens.
